    I have a Caldigit HDONE I am using the Windows 2.1.3 on Windows 7 I was getting random blue screens Storport.s​ys IRQL not Less or Equal When Accessing Caldigit HDONE Raid this only happens when I am accessing the Caldigit after lots of video editing direct from the Raid. Caldigit support never got back to me on this on going issue.

    I am on a brand new machine Windows 8 the driver installs 2.1.3 I run as administrator and also tried in compatibility mode Windows 7 under the Windows 8 install it shows in the device manager as error code 10 the driver cannot be started. So I deleted the driver from device manager installed the driver form the separate folder called driver form the 2.1.3 Caldigit package.

    It shows up the Raid as in the hard drive then after a reboot it then is not even showing in disk manager. I tried it under Windows 7 and it seems to work fine apart form the random blue screens as described above.

    It looks like there’s no Windows 8 support for the HD One’s controller. I think that controller is actually an Accusys 62000 (or 61000), so maybe you can find Win 8 drivers for it somewhere other than Caldigit’s site if you don’t have any luck getting a response from them.

    I managed to call Caldigit UK I mentioned that on Windows 7 64bit I was getting Blue screens of death when accessing the raid. They said they have some problems in 64bit and suggested I use 32bit. I am going to look at an alternative raid which supports 64bit and works in 7 and 8 of Windows 64bit editions.
